Abstract

New chromanone and aurone hybrids have been synthesized by conventional and microwave induced methods from substituted (E)-7-hydroxy-6-[3-(p-tolyl)acryloyl]spiro[chroman-2,1'-cyclohexan]-4-one with high yields. Structures of the synthesized compounds have been elucidated from IR, 1H and 13C NMR, and mass spectra. All newly synthesized compounds were tested in vitro for their antimicrobial activity. Methoxysubstituted spirochromanones revealed the best antimicrobial profile.
